您的位置:首页 > 运维架构 > Linux

Linux26期 6月4日预习笔记

2020-02-05 08:07 225 查看

2.6 相对和绝对路径

2.7 cd命令

2.8 创建和删除目录   mkdir/rmdir

2.9 rm命令

2.6 相对和绝对路径

绝对路径:路径的写法一定是由根目录/写起的,例如 /usr/local/mysql

相对路径:路径的写法不是有根目录/写起的。例如:首先用户进入到 /home ,然后再进入到 test ,执行的命令为:  #cd /home           #cd test

命令cd (change directory),是用来变更用户所在目录的,后面如果什么都不跟,就会直接进入当前用户的根目录下。命令cd 后面只能跟目录名,如果跟了文件名,则会报错。

命令pwd:用于显示当前所在目录。

上面例子,我们做实验用的是root账户,所以运行命令cd 后,会进入root 账户的根目录/root下。

上面例子,cd后面直接跟目录名,则会直接切换到指定目录下。

上面例子,首先进入/usr/local/lib/目录,接着输入 . ,用命令pwd查看当前目录,还是在use/local/lib/目录下,然后输入 ..,则进入/usr/local/目录,也就是说 /usr/local/ 是 /usr/local/lib 目录的上一级目录。

符号”."表示当前目录,符号“.." 表示当前目录的上一级目录。

 

 

2.7 cd命令:功能:切换目录。    用法:cd{目的目录}

常用: (1)cd -  (反复切换)   (2) cd ~ (跳到自己的home  directory)

(3)cd ..               (4)cd ../..   ()跳到目前目录的上上两层

   

 

2.8 创建和删除目录mkdir/rmdir

mkdir命令:   功能:建立目录。   用法: mkdir {-p} 表示如果所建目录的上层目录目前还没建立,则会一并建立上层目录。     或  mkdir {-pv} 表示在创建目录时显示创建过程

 

rmdir命令(remove directory)用于删除空目录,,该命令只能删除目录,不能删除文件。rmdir 和mkdir具有相同选项 -p,它同样级联删除一大串目录,所以一般不建议使用。而改用rm 命令代替。

 

 

2.9 rm命令:功能:删除文件或目录。常用选项 -r 和 -f 

#rm -r  删除目录用的选项,类似于rmdir,但可以删除非空目录。

例:先创建一连串的目录,然后再尝试删除他们。  和rmdir不同的是,使用rm -r 命令删除目录时,会问是否删除,如果输入”y"则会删除,如果输入"n"则不删除。另外,rm -r 命令能删除非空目录。

#rm -f 表示强制删除。它不再询问是否删除,而是直接删除。如果后面跟一个不存在的文件或目录时,则不会报错。

例:

但如果要删除一个存在的目录时,即使加上 -f 选项也会报错。所以使用命令rm删除目录时,一定要加上 -r,也就是#rm -rf 。

关于rm命令,使用最多的时-rf选项,这样删除目录或文件比较方便。注意: -rm -rf 命令后面不能加 “/”,否则会把系统的文件全部删除,很危险。

 

转载于:https://my.oschina.net/u/3851620/blog/1823588

  • 点赞
  • 收藏
  • 分享
  • 文章举报
chougenong2883 发布了0 篇原创文章 · 获赞 0 · 访问量 111 私信 关注
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: